Understanding GEOL313: Environmental Geology

Course Overview

GEOL313 is a comprehensive course offered by the Faculty of Science at UNE, focusing on the study of geological processes and their impact on the environment. It aims to equip students with the knowledge to analyze environmental issues through a geological lens, covering topics such as earth systems, natural hazards, and resource management.

Key Topics Covered

The course delves into various key areas, including mineral and energy resources, soil and water pollution, and the geological aspects of climate change. Students also explore the role of geology in sustainable development, providing a holistic understanding of the subject.

The Importance of Environmental Geology Today

Relevance to Current Environmental Issues

Environmental geology plays a pivotal role in addressing pressing environmental challenges. Understanding geological processes aids in disaster risk reduction, resource management, and mitigating climate change impacts.

Career Opportunities in Environmental Geology

Proficiency in environmental geology opens doors to diverse career pathways, including environmental consultancy, natural resource management, and academic research. The skills acquired in GEOL313 are highly valued in these fields.
